Output 6c5f76ebf048fb8e4c0bf76c91bc977ecf8b659c14f8ae97293740fa4ba7400a:1

value
1033699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e622efdbed59577f2d55f22f789d164127279098 OP_EQUAL
address
3NfsC8J1b2utP28MjEB4YEYT8nSe6szQwY
transaction
6c5f76ebf048fb8e4c0bf76c91bc977ecf8b659c14f8ae97293740fa4ba7400a
confirmations
333034
spent
true